Our Toddler Social Playgroups are designed to develop essential social skills, bridging the gap between parallel play (playing alongside others) and cooperative play (playing with others).

Multiple activities available in the space require mastering the concept of taking turns; including slides, balance beams, climbing toys, giant building blocks, and our magnet wall. The host may help parents and toddlers resolve minor squabbles but this playgroup is mostly about natural open-ended social play with minimal instructor input.
